Do Jews believe that they are he chosen people?

0

Some do. God made a ‘covenant’ with Abraham. He told Abraham that if his family followed God and served him, he would protect them, give them a permanent home, and make them multiply. This was in the 18th chapter of Genesis. Now some Jews today believe that God simply chose Jews because he loves them, but in fact it was a contract with two sides. God promised to favor the Jews so long as they served him. It’s not a free gift. And in my observation, people of nearly every religion believes that God loves them more than other faiths, because their religion is closer to the truth, and that pleases God, and the other ‘false’ religions anger God. So it’s nothing unique among Jews. Christians, in particular, believed from just after the time of Jesus that the Jews had lost their covenant with God because they killed their own Messiah. They believe there is a ‘new covenant’ with Christians.
